Lithuania - Primary Solid Biofuels Final Consumption in Textile and Leather Sector

Since 2014, Lithuania Primary Solid Biofuels Final Consumption in Textile and Leather Sector grew 22.7%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 10 among other countries in Primary Solid Biofuels Final Consumption in Textile and Leather Sector with 6.94 Gigawatthours. Lithuania is overtaken by Denmark, which was number 9 at 7.17 Gigawatthours and is followed by Slovenia with 4.65 Gigawatthours. Serbia lead the ranking with 232.55 Gigawatthours in 2019, that is -1.6% compared to 2018. Portugal recorded the best 5 years average growth at +45.9% per year, while Belgium was the worst growing country at -100% per year.
